Abstract
Abstract
The abstract describing the content of the publication or report
Abstract:
A series of three trenches were excavated across the boundary to investigate the potential survival of buried archaeological and palaeoenvironmental deposits beneath the hedgebank. The excavation of trench 2 revealed that the ground level either side of the bank had been raised by the dumping of modern stony material. To the north east of the bank was a shallow contemporaneous ditch. Sealed beneath the bank was two post holes, each containing stone packing and post pipes. No artefacts or datable material was recovered from their fills. Trench 3 showed the bank, like in trench 2, to be constructed of redeposited sandy clay natural. No buried soil was preserved, and no artefacts were recovered. [Au(adp)]
